Peru's ambitious laptop program gets mixed grades - Yahoo! News - 0 views
-
what we did was deliver the computers without preparing the teachers
-
the missteps may have actually widened the gap between children able to benefit from the computers and those ill-equipped to do so
-
Inter-American Development Bank researchers were less polite."There is little solid evidence regarding the effectiveness of this program," they said in a study sharply critical of the overall OLPC initiative that was based on a 15-month study at 319 schools in small, rural Peruvian communities that got laptops."The magical thinking that mere technology is enough to spur change, to improve learning, is what this study categorically disproves," co-author Eugenio Severin of Chile told The Associated Press
